Abstract
Abstractp-Methoxybenzoyldialkylphosphonates, terephtaloylbis(dialkylphosphonates), (alkyl=methyl, ethyl), p-methoxybenzoyldiphenylphosphine oxide and terephtaloylbis(diphenylphosphine oxide) were synthesized by Michaelis–Arbuzov reaction. These compounds were used as photoinitiators for radical polymerization of acrylic monomer 1,6-hexandiol diacrylate. The photoinitiating activity was determined by differential photocalorimetry (DPC), in isothermal conditions, using 1,6-hexandiol diacrylate as monomer, in the absence of amines and in the presence of amines as synergist additive. The influence of amine on photoreactivity parameters was studied. The kinetic study of polymerization of 1,6-hexandiol diacrylate sensitized by these radical photoinitiators have been studied by DPC. These compounds performed good photoinitiating activity in comparison with commercial product Lucirin TPO (2,4,6-trimethylbenzoyldiphenylphosphine oxide).
